数据库 图书管理系统
设计一个图书管理系统,图书管理系统是图书馆的重要组成部分,设计和开发一个中小型高校图书馆管理系统,阐述了高校图书管理软件中所应具有的功能、设计、实现,主要是针对图书信息、读者信息、读者的借阅信息进行管理。包括对新书的入库信息进行详细记录,包括书名、书号、作者、单价、出版社数量等,对各种图书的借阅情况进行详细的记录,对图书信息进行各种查询,对新读者信息进行详细的记录以及对读者信息进行详细的查询,对读者借阅情况进行查询,以及对图书的挂失、借阅证的挂失等。
2. 设计意义
通过本图书管理系统软件,能帮助图书库存管理人员利用计算机,快速方便的对图书进行管理、读者信息记录、借阅信息记录、查找所需操作,主要是针对图书信息、读者信息、读者的借阅信息进行管理。图书管理系统主要是为图书借阅人提供方便快捷的服务,以及为图书管理人员提供可靠的信息与帮助,其具体的意义如下:
1. 提高图书管理的效率,节约相关的管理成本。
2. 为学校提供系统,规范的图书管理手段。
3. 增强图书管理的安全性。
4. 满足借阅人和图书管理人员以及相关学校领导的不同层次和不同方面的需要。
3. 主要功能
1. 对图书馆的各种图书的详细信息进行录入;
2. 记录新图书的入库等信息,对图书的借阅信息进行各种查询,以及对读者的详细信息进行查询。
代码片段和文件信息
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 1409 2011-06-16 21:31 数据库课程设计 图书馆管理MFClibrary4BOOK.cpp
文件 1314 2011-06-16 22:36 数据库课程设计 图书馆管理MFClibrary4BOOK.h
文件 5206 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4BOOK1.cpp
文件 1590 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4BOOK1.h
文件 16677 2011-06-16 22:36 数据库课程设计 图书馆管理MFClibrary4DebugBOOK.obj
文件 35597 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4DebugBOOK1.obj
文件 139369 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.exe
文件 400576 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.ilk
文件 17474 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.obj
文件 5502692 2011-06-16 00:19 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.pch
文件 508928 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.pdb
文件 4128 2011-06-17 01:09 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.res
文件 14894 2011-06-16 18:00 数据库课程设计 图书馆管理MFClibrary4DebugLIBRARY41.obj
文件 35223 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4Dlg.obj
文件 25601 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4DebugONTROL.obj
文件 13655 2011-06-16 14:59 数据库课程设计 图书馆管理MFClibrary4DebugONTROL1.obj
文件 13085 2011-06-16 14:39 数据库课程设计 图书馆管理MFClibrary4DebugONTROLER.obj
文件 15399 2011-06-16 14:06 数据库课程设计 图书馆管理MFClibrary4DebugReader.obj
文件 16206 2011-06-16 21:11 数据库课程设计 图书馆管理MFClibrary4DebugREADER2.obj
文件 16513 2011-06-16 14:10 数据库课程设计 图书馆管理MFClibrary4DebugREADERINFORN.obj
文件 40996 2011-06-17 01:00 数据库课程设计 图书馆管理MFClibrary4DebugREADER_.obj
文件 105886 2011-06-16 23:12 数据库课程设计 图书馆管理MFClibrary4DebugStdAfx.obj
文件 246784 2011-06-17 01:28 数据库课程设计 图书馆管理MFClibrary4Debugvc60.idb
文件 389120 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debugvc60.pdb
文件 20187 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4DebugWELCOM.obj
文件 38424 2011-06-17 01:09 数据库课程设计 图书馆管理MFClibrary4library4.aps
文件 6473 2011-06-17 01:40 数据库课程设计 图书馆管理MFClibrary4library4.clw
文件 2091 2011-06-15 23:29 数据库课程设计 图书馆管理MFClibrary4library4.cpp
文件 5318 2011-06-17 01:28 数据库课程设计 图书馆管理MFClibrary4library4.dsp
文件 541 2011-06-15 23:29 数据库课程设计 图书馆管理MFClibrary4library4.dsw
............此处省略45个文件信息
// BOOK.cpp : implementation file
//
#include “stdafx.h“
#include “library4.h“
#include “BOOK.h“
#ifdef _DEBUG
#define new DEBUG_NEW
#undef THIS_FILE
static char THIS_FILE[] = __FILE__;
#endif
/////////////////////////////////////////////////////////////////////////////
// BOOK
IMPLEMENT_DYNAMIC(BOOK CRecordset)
BOOK::BOOK(CDatabase* pdb)
: CRecordset(pdb)
{
//{{AFX_FIELD_INIT(BOOK)
m_BOOK_ID = _T(““);
m_BOOK_NAME = _T(““);
m_CONCERN = _T(““);
m_AUTHOR = _T(““);
m_PRINT_DATE = _T(““);
m_nFields = 5;
//}}AFX_FIELD_INIT
m_nDefaultType = snapshot;
}
CString BOOK::GetDefaultConnect()
{
return _T(“ODBC;DSN=LIBRARY“);
}
CString BOOK::GetDefaultSQL()
{
return _T(“[dbo].[BOOK]“);
}
void BOOK::DoFieldExchange(CFieldExchange* pFX)
{
//{{AFX_FIELD_MAP(BOOK)
pFX->SetFieldType(CFieldExchange::outputColumn);
RFX_Text(pFX _T(“[BOOK_ID]“) m_BOOK_ID);
RFX_Text(pFX _T(“[BOOK_NAME]“) m_BOOK_NAME);
RFX_Text(pFX _T(“[CONCERN]“) m_CONCERN);
RFX_Text(pFX _T(“[AUTHOR]“) m_AUTHOR);
RFX_Text(pFX _T(“[PRINT_DATE]“) m_PRINT_DATE);
//}}AFX_FIELD_MAP
}
/////////////////////////////////////////////////////////////////////////////
// BOOK diagnostics
#ifdef _DEBUG
void BOOK::AssertValid() const
{
CRecordset::AssertValid();
}
void BOOK::Dump(CDumpContext& dc) const
{
CRecordset::Dump(dc);
}
#endif //_DEBUG
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 1409 2011-06-16 21:31 数据库课程设计 图书馆管理MFClibrary4BOOK.cpp
文件 1314 2011-06-16 22:36 数据库课程设计 图书馆管理MFClibrary4BOOK.h
文件 5206 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4BOOK1.cpp
文件 1590 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4BOOK1.h
文件 16677 2011-06-16 22:36 数据库课程设计 图书馆管理MFClibrary4DebugBOOK.obj
文件 35597 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4DebugBOOK1.obj
文件 139369 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.exe
文件 400576 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.ilk
文件 17474 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.obj
文件 5502692 2011-06-16 00:19 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.pch
文件 508928 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.pdb
文件 4128 2011-06-17 01:09 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4.res
文件 14894 2011-06-16 18:00 数据库课程设计 图书馆管理MFClibrary4DebugLIBRARY41.obj
文件 35223 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4Debuglibrary4Dlg.obj
文件 25601 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4DebugONTROL.obj
文件 13655 2011-06-16 14:59 数据库课程设计 图书馆管理MFClibrary4DebugONTROL1.obj
文件 13085 2011-06-16 14:39 数据库课程设计 图书馆管理MFClibrary4DebugONTROLER.obj
文件 15399 2011-06-16 14:06 数据库课程设计 图书馆管理MFClibrary4DebugReader.obj
文件 16206 2011-06-16 21:11 数据库课程设计 图书馆管理MFClibrary4DebugREADER2.obj
文件 16513 2011-06-16 14:10 数据库课程设计 图书馆管理MFClibrary4DebugREADERINFORN.obj
文件 40996 2011-06-17 01:00 数据库课程设计 图书馆管理MFClibrary4DebugREADER_.obj
文件 105886 2011-06-16 23:12 数据库课程设计 图书馆管理MFClibrary4DebugStdAfx.obj
文件 246784 2011-06-17 01:28 数据库课程设计 图书馆管理MFClibrary4Debugvc60.idb
文件 389120 2011-06-17 01:27 数据库课程设计 图书馆管理MFClibrary4Debugvc60.pdb
文件 20187 2011-06-17 00:54 数据库课程设计 图书馆管理MFClibrary4DebugWELCOM.obj
文件 38424 2011-06-17 01:09 数据库课程设计 图书馆管理MFClibrary4library4.aps
文件 6473 2011-06-17 01:40 数据库课程设计 图书馆管理MFClibrary4library4.clw
文件 2091 2011-06-15 23:29 数据库课程设计 图书馆管理MFClibrary4library4.cpp
文件 5318 2011-06-17 01:28 数据库课程设计 图书馆管理MFClibrary4library4.dsp
文件 541 2011-06-15 23:29 数据库课程设计 图书馆管理MFClibrary4library4.dsw
............此处省略45个文件信息
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。
评论列表(条)